Villagers rescue 72-yr.-old in boat mishap By Joe A. Medinilla
JIMALALUD, Negros Oriental - A fisherman from the town of Jimalalud found a 72-year old man floating on the high seas Monday after the latter's fishing boat capsized because of strong waves on the night of March 8.
Police identified the half-sick victim as Damaso Sabado, married, a resident of Guihulngan, two towns away from Jimalalud.
The fisherman Edward Estorco, 42, married, of Barangay Dayoyo, Jimalalud, Negros Oriental said he was fishing off the coast at around 8:00 a.m. when he found Sabado floating on the sea.
Villagers immediately treated the victim for a minor injury sustained during his two-day sea ordeal and returned to his home in Guihulngan early that afternoon.
